Comparison of Gas Prices in Ireland
Gas Prices in Ireland Compared Bord Gais Energy (which is owned by UK-based firm Centrica) has 6 competitors for the supply of Natural Gas to households in Ireland. The other gas suppliers in Ireland are Flogas, SSE Airtricity, Electric Ireland, Energia and Prepay Power . All the energy suppliers increased gas prices by large amounts […]

How Much Does it Cost to Charge an Electric Car in Ireland ?
Cost of Charging an Electric Car at Home The cost of charging an electric car at home will typically cost significantly less than using public charging points. For example – someone with a day/night meter, charging a car at home overnight will pay about 18.87c per kwh That would work out at about €3.11 for […]
